Is Panzer General still worth playing in 2026?

A turn based wargame from SSI ported to PlayStation, Panzer General revives the great campaigns of the Second World War on a hex map, where you command units that gain experience from one battle to the next. The clarity of the system, the career progression and the strategic tension stay surprisingly accessible and addictive. The pad adapted interface is less supple than on PC. A classic of historical strategy for fans of wargames and military thinking.
